Three suspected extortionists arrested in Cape Town
Suspects were in a vehicle and allegedly demanding money from businesses, in Cape Town.
Three suspected extortionists have been apprehended in Strand, Cape Town, for illegally possessing firearms and ammunition. According to police spokesperson Ndakhe Gwala, the individuals were part of Operation Lockdown Three, who received information about three armed suspects in the area. The suspects were reportedly in a vehicle demanding money from businesses when they were spotted at Xaki Street, Strand around 9:30 PM.
One suspect attempted to flee with a plastic bag but was apprehended, along with two firearms and 15 rounds of ammunition. Gwala announced that the three suspects would appear in the Strand Magistrate’s Court on Tuesday.
